随着互联网技术的飞速发展,学校网站的构建和优化已成为教育信息化的重要组成部分,本文将深入探讨学校网站源码的结构、功能以及如何通过优化提升用户体验和搜索引擎排名。
学校网站源码概述
学校网站通常包括首页、课程信息、教师介绍、学生作品展示等多个模块,这些模块通过HTML、CSS和JavaScript等前端技术实现,后端则可能使用PHP、Python或Java等技术进行数据处理和存储。
HTML结构
HTML是构成网页的基础,它定义了页面的基本结构和内容,在学校的网站上,HTML文件通常会包含导航栏、头部图片、主要内容区和底部版权等信息。
<!DOCTYPE html> <html lang="zh-CN"> <head> <meta charset="UTF-8"> <title>学校名称</title> <link rel="stylesheet" href="styles.css"> </head> <body> <header> <nav> <ul> <li><a href="#home">首页</a></li> <li><a href="#courses">课程信息</a></li> <li><a href="#teachers">教师介绍</a></li> <li><a href="#students">学生作品</a></li> </ul> </nav> <img src="header.jpg" alt="学校标志"> </header> <main> <section id="courses"> <!-- 课程信息 --> </section> <section id="teachers"> <!-- 教师介绍 --> </section> <section id="students"> <!-- 学生作品 --> </section> </main> <footer> © 2023 学校名称 </footer> </body> </html>
CSS样式
CSS用于控制网页的外观和布局,对于学校网站来说,合理的CSS设计可以提升用户的阅读体验。
body { font-family: Arial, sans-serif; } header { background-color: #f0f0f0; padding: 20px; text-align: center; } nav ul { list-style-type: none; margin: 0; padding: 0; display: inline-block; } nav li { display: inline; margin-right: 10px; } nav a { text-decoration: none; color: black; } main { padding: 20px; } footer { text-align: center; padding: 10px; background-color: #e0e0e0; }
JavaScript交互
JavaScript用于实现动态效果和增强用户体验,可以使用JavaScript来处理表单验证、轮播图显示等功能。
图片来源于网络,如有侵权联系删除
document.addEventListener("DOMContentLoaded", function() { var navLinks = document.querySelectorAll("nav a"); navLinks.forEach(function(link) { link.addEventListener("click", function(event) { event.preventDefault(); // 实现页面滚动到相应位置的功能 }); }); });
学校网站优化策略
为了提高学校网站的访问量和知名度,需要进行有效的SEO(搜索引擎优化)和用户体验优化。
SEO优化
关键词研究
关键词研究是SEO的基础,需要分析潜在访客可能会使用的搜索词汇,并在网站内容中合理地融入这些关键词。
内容创作
高质量的内容是吸引蜘蛛爬虫的重要因素,定期更新博客文章、课程信息和活动报道等,可以提高网站的权威性和相关性。
网站结构优化
确保网站结构清晰,URL简洁明了,使用语义化的HTML标签,如<article>
、<section>
等,有助于搜索引擎更好地理解页面内容。
图片优化
为所有图片添加描述性alt属性,不仅可以提升可访问性,还能增加图片被搜索引擎索引的机会。
用户体验优化
页面加载速度
使用CDN加速静态资源分发,压缩图片和JS/CSS文件,减少HTTP请求次数,从而加快页面加载速度。
图片来源于网络,如有侵权联系删除
无障碍设计
遵循Web Content Accessibility Guidelines(WCAG),使网站对视力障碍者、听力障碍者和肢体障碍者友好。
易用性设计
保持一致的视觉风格和操作流程,简化导航路径,让用户能够轻松找到所需的信息。
案例分享
以某知名大学为例,其官方网站采用了现代化的响应式设计和丰富的多媒体元素,吸引了大量国内外学生和家长的关注,该网站不仅提供了详尽的学术资源和招生信息,还设有在线申请系统,极大地方便了申请人。
随着5G技术和AI的发展,学校网站的未来发展趋势将更加注重智能化和个性化服务,利用机器学习算法为学生推荐最适合的课程,或者通过虚拟现实技术提供沉浸式的教学体验。
学校网站的构建和优化是一个持续的过程,需要不断学习和实践。
标签: #学校 网站源码
评论列表